#c1bdb4 color RGB value is (193,189,180). #c1bdb4 color name is Custom Color color.

#c1bdb4 hex color red value is 193, green value is 189 and the blue value of its RGB is 180.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#c1bdb4 hue: 0.12, saturation: 0.09 and the lightness value of c1bdb4 is 0.73.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#c1bdb4 color hex is 0.00, 0.02, 0.07, 0.24. Web safe color of #c1bdb4 is #cccccc. Color #c1bdb4 contains mainly GRAY color.

About #C1BDB4 Custom Color

#C1BDB4 (Custom Color) is a gray-based color with RGB values of 193, 189, 180. This color belongs to the gray color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#c1bdb4,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#c1bdb4 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#c1bdb4), RGB (rgb(193, 189, 180)), HSL (hsl(42, 9%, 73%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cccccc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
